PDF转换为CHM:专业指南与高效工具推荐
引言
在数字化文档管理中,PDF和CHM是两种广泛使用的格式。PDF以其跨平台一致性和安全性著称,而CHM(编译HTML帮助)则常用于技术文档和电子书,支持目录导航和全文搜索,非常适合离线查阅。将PDF转换为CHM,可以提升文档的交互性和可访问性,尤其适用于帮助系统、技术手册或知识库构建。
PDF与CHM格式对比
| 特性 | CHM | |
|---|---|---|
| 文件结构 | 固定版式,注重打印效果 | 基于HTML,支持动态内容 |
| 交互性 | 有限(表单、注释) | 强大(目录、索引、搜索) |
| 适用场景 | 电子文档分发、打印 | 帮助系统、电子书、在线文档 |
| 编辑难度 | 较高 | 较易(可通过HTML编辑) |
转换原理与挑战
PDF转CHM的核心是将PDF的固定页面内容提取并重组为结构化的HTML文件,再编译为CHM。主要挑战包括:
- 布局保留:PDF的复杂排版(如表格、多栏)可能在转换后变形。
- 图片与字体:高分辨率图片和特殊字体需确保兼容性。
- 链接与目录:原PDF的超链接和书签需映射为CHM的导航结构。
专业转换工具推荐
1. Adobe Acrobat Pro DC
作为官方工具,支持直接导出为HTML,再通过HelpNDoc等工具编译为CHM。优点:高质量转换;缺点:成本较高。
2. FlipHTML5
在线转换平台,支持PDF转CHM并自定义样式。适合快速转换,但免费版有文件大小限制。
3. HelpNDoc
专业帮助文档创作工具,可导入PDF生成CHM,支持批量处理和模板定制。
4. Pandoc + Calibre
开源组合:Pandoc用于PDF转HTML,Calibre用于编译CHM。适合技术用户,灵活性高。
操作步骤示例(以HelpNDoc为例)
- 导入PDF:打开HelpNDoc,选择“导入”功能,加载PDF文件。
- 提取内容:工具自动解析文本、图片和结构,用户可手动调整章节。
- 设计导航:添加目录、索引和搜索关键词。
- 编译CHM:设置输出选项(如图标、标题),点击生成CHM文件。
- 测试与优化:在Windows帮助查看器中测试,修复链接或布局问题。
常见问题与解决方案
- 乱码问题:确保源PDF使用标准字体,或在转换前嵌入字体。
- 图片缺失:检查PDF是否为扫描件,必要时使用OCR预处理。
- 目录错位:手动映射章节标题,或使用工具自动检测功能。
最佳实践建议
- 文档预处理:转换前优化PDF,如添加书签、清理冗余内容。
- 分批次转换:大型PDF建议分段处理,避免工具崩溃。
- 多格式备份:保留源文件,以便后续更新或重新转换。
总结
PDF转CHM并非简单格式替换,而是文档交互性的升级。通过选择合适的工具并遵循系统化流程,您可以高效生成结构清晰、易于导航的CHM文件,适用于技术文档、电子书或企业知识库。随着AI辅助工具的发展,未来转换的智能化和准确性将进一步提升,为文档管理带来更多便利。